Women's Soccer drops 4-3 decision to Heidelberg
September 28, 2016
BLUFFTON, Ohio - The Heidelberg University women's soccer team led 4-1 with less than two minutes to play before a pair of Bluffton tallies gave the Beavers momentum heading into Heartland Conference play this weekend despite a 4-3 loss to the Student Princes on an overcast Wednesday, Sept. 28. Bluffton ends non-conference play with a 0-5 mark, while Heidelberg goes into OAC action with a 5-3-2 mark.
Junior defender Brittany Huff (Union/Northmont) hit from the back forty in minute 14 for Bluffton's first tally of the season, putting the home team on top 1-0! McKenzie Perry made it 1-1 midway through the period with her first goal of the season thanks to a nice feed from Denise Bowes.
Perry hit paydirt again in minute 57, putting the Student Princes up 2-1. Shae-Lynn Hallowell made it 3-1 just five minutes later before the teams combined for three goals in the final 3;12 of the match. Maureen Kelly seemingly iced the contest with her goal at the 86:48 mark, but the Beavers didn't get the memo.
Freshman Katie Spalding (Perrysburg/Owens Community College) headed in Skylar Liming's (St. Marys/Memorial)) corner kick inside of two minutes and Brittany Huff found Erica Keller (Swanton) with less than a minute to play, forcing Heidelberg to play keep-away for the final 40 seconds as the Student Princes barely held on for the 4-3 victory.
The visitors finished with a 30-8 edge in shots. Bluffton ended the afternoon with three corner kicks and nine fouls, compared to a pair of corners and eight fouls for Student Princes. Freshman keeper Kayla Penrod (Marysville) was back in goal and she was solid with 14 saves.
Bluffton will look to use the momentum gained during the final minutes of tonight's match when the Beavers open Heartland Conference play on Saturday afternoon.
